The Freedom of No Connectivity
One of the primary attractions of offline games is the freedom they provide. Imagine being on a long flight or at a remote location without internet access – offline games ensure that your gaming experience is uninterrupted. Here’s a list of reasons why this kind of gaming can be liberating:
- No Internet Latency: Enjoy seamless gameplay without the frustration of lag.
- Battery Life Saver: Playing offline conserves battery life for your devices.
- Focus and Concentration: Without notifications and distractions from the internet, you can immerse yourself fully in the game.

Relaxation and Stress Relief
The immersive nature of offline games offers an excellent method for stress relief. With nothing but the game to focus on, players often find themselves escaping into different worlds. Whether it's slaying monsters or building civilizations, the sense of achievement and engagement can significantly elevate mood. Here are key points to consider:
- Therapeutic Benefits: Engaging in gameplay can serve as a form of therapy.
- Escapism: Provides an avenue to temporarily disengage from real-life concerns.
- Creativity Boost: Many offline games encourage creativity through storylines and character development.
